The ciliary body and the choroid plexus within the lateral ventricles of the brain produce the aqueous humor in the eye. The aqueous humor nourishes the cornea and the lens, provides intraocular pressure, and removes waste from the anterior chamber of the eye.
No, bipolar cells are a type of neuron found in the retina of the eye, not in the ciliary ganglion. The ciliary ganglion primarily contains postganglionic parasympathetic neurons that innervate the muscles controlling the shape of the lens in the eye.
The suspensory ligaments, also known as zonules, connect the ciliary body to the lens. These ligaments play a crucial role in controlling the shape and accommodation of the lens for focusing on objects at different distances.

The ciliary body plays a crucial role in the eye by producing aqueous humor, which helps maintain eye pressure and nourish the surrounding tissues. It also controls the shape and thickness of the lens to facilitate focusing on objects at various distances through a process called accommodation.

The zonule, also known as the zonular fibers, helps to hold the lens of the eye in place behind the pupil. It is a delicate system of fibers that connects the ciliary body to the lens, allowing the lens to change shape for focusing on objects at different distances.
